Resveratrol-Potential Antibacterial Agent against Foodborne Pathogens
Dexter S L Ma1,2, Loh Teng-Hern Tan1,2,3, Kok-Gan Chan4,5
1Biofunctional Molecule Exploratory Research Group, School of Pharmacy, Monash University Malaysia, Bandar Sunway, Malaysia.
Resveratrol shows promise as a natural antimicrobial agent against foodborne pathogens. This review explores its antibacterial activity, mechanisms, and potential applications in food safety and processing.
Area of Science:
- Food Science
- Microbiology
- Pharmacology
Background:
- Antibiotic resistance in foodborne pathogens is a growing global health concern.
- Natural antimicrobials from plants are being investigated as alternatives to conventional antibiotics.
- Resveratrol, a plant-derived stilbenoid, possesses various biological activities, including potential antimicrobial properties.
Purpose of the Study:
- To review the antibacterial activity of resveratrol against foodborne pathogens.
- To elucidate the mechanisms of action of resveratrol's antimicrobial effects.
- To explore potential applications of resveratrol in food preservation and processing.
Main Methods:
- Literature review of published studies on resveratrol and foodborne pathogens.
- Analysis of data on resveratrol's antibacterial efficacy and mechanisms.
- Summary of research on synergistic effects with existing antibiotics.
Main Results:
- Resveratrol demonstrates significant antibacterial activity against various foodborne pathogens.
- Its mechanisms of action involve disruption of bacterial cell membranes and metabolic pathways.
- Potential for synergistic effects with conventional antibiotics was observed.
Conclusions:
- Resveratrol is a promising natural antimicrobial agent for combating foodborne bacterial infections.
- Further research is warranted for its application in food packaging and processing to enhance food safety.
- Exploring synergistic combinations could help overcome antibiotic resistance challenges.
